Hiya London

The superfast and convenient Eurostar is always a good excuse for a weekend in London. I was there for a couple of days last week and spent my time doing not much more than enjoying being back in one of my favourite cities. London is a city I love to get lost in, where I can walk for hours with no particular destination in mind - stopping only for some window shopping and always with a takeaway Monmouth coffee in tow. I try to explore a different part of the city each time I visit and I love how the diversity of the city continues to surprise and inspire me each time. From the grandeur and opulence of Westminster to the rugged simplicity of the small backstreets - these are my favourites, with truly British style brickwork, old school piping, beautiful big windows, awesome street art and of course the best shops hidden down little alleys.
